CDN 為什么能加速?核心在于“就近訪問”
想象一下,你的網站服務器在美國。一位北京的用戶每次訪問,請求都需要橫跨整個太平洋,經過多個國際網絡節點才能獲取數據。這會導致:
高延遲:數據往返一次需要幾百毫秒,感覺“卡頓”。
低速下載:長距離傳輸和網絡擁堵導致帶寬不穩定,加載圖片、視頻非常慢。
高丟包率:在復雜的國際鏈路上,數據包容易丟失,導致傳輸失敗、頁面錯亂。
CDN的解決方案是:
在全球各地部署大量的緩存服務器(也叫“邊緣節點”)。當中國大陸用戶訪問你的國外網站時,CDN會通過智能調度系統,將用戶引導到離他最近、速度最快的節點上(例如位于中國大陸的節點,或者中國香港、新加坡、日本等周邊優質節點)。
用戶請求靜態資源(如圖片、CSS、JavaScript、視頻):直接從本地或附近的CDN節點下載,無需繞道美國,速度極快。
用戶請求動態內容(如數據庫查詢、用戶登錄):CDN會通過優化過的、更穩定的國際骨干網線路回源到你的美國服務器,雖然不能像靜態資源那樣“本地化”,但也能通過更優的路由降低延遲和丟包。
使用CDN后,速度提升是肉眼可見的:
首屏加載時間:從原來的幾秒甚至十幾秒,縮短到1-3秒內。
資源加載:圖片、樣式表等靜態元素幾乎可以瞬間加載完畢。
視頻播放:緩沖時間大大減少,可以實現高清流暢播放。
網站穩定性:即使你的國外源服務器出現短暫波動或多個用戶同時訪問,由于壓力被分散到各個CDN節點,國內用戶也能正常訪問,體驗更穩定。
并非所有CDN都能同等地優化中國大陸的訪問速度。 這是最核心的一點。
必須擁有“中國大陸優化”節點或“中國大陸直連”線路
最佳選擇(有備案域名):選擇像阿里云CDN、騰訊云CDN、恒訊科技 這樣在中國大陸擁有大量節點的服務商。它們在國內網絡質量最好,但前提是你的域名必須已經完成了工信部的ICP備案。
次優選擇(無備案域名):如果你的域名沒有備案,可以選擇那些專門為中國大陸優化的國際CDN服務商,例如:
Cloudflare:其免費計劃對部分國內線路有優化,但效果不穩定。付費計劃(如Pro或Business)結合其“中國網絡優化”選項,效果會好很多。
AWS CloudFront / Google Cloud CDN:它們在全球有眾多節點,包括亞洲邊緣節點,對國內訪問有一定加速效果,但不如專門優化的服務商。
專門面向中國市場的CDN服務:一些服務商專門提供針對中國市場的CDN解決方案,它們通常與國內運營商有深度合作。
區分“全站加速”和“靜態資源加速”
靜態資源加速:這是CDN最擅長、效果最明顯的部分。幾乎可以無腦配置。
動態加速:對于需要與源服務器實時交互的請求,需要CDN服務商提供“動態加速”或“全站加速”功能,通過智能路由技術(如BGP優化、TCP優化)來優化回源路徑。
ICP備案問題:如上所述,如果你想使用中國大陸境內的CDN節點,域名備案是強制性的。否則,你的網站內容只能緩存到中國大陸境外的節點(如香港、新加坡),加速效果會打折扣,但依然遠好于直接訪問美國源站。
內容合規性:如果使用中國大陸節點,CDN服務商會對內容進行審查,不符合中國法律法規的內容會被屏蔽。
成本:高質量的CDN服務(尤其是針對中國大陸優化的)通常是收費的。你需要權衡加速效果帶來的業務收益與CDN的成本。
使用CDN是提升國外網站國內訪問速度最有效、最經濟的方案之一。
對于靜態內容居多的網站(如博客、新聞站、電商產品頁),CDN能帶來革命性的速度提升。
對于動態交互多的網站(如論壇、社交網絡、后臺系統),CDN也能通過優化網絡路徑,顯著降低延遲和提升穩定性。
如果你的國外網站有大量中國用戶,強烈建議你立即部署CDN。優先選擇那些明確標明“對中國大陸優化”的服務商,并根據自己是否有備案域名來做出最終選擇。這步投資對于提升用戶體驗、降低跳出率和增加轉化率至關重要。
Copyright ? 2013-2020. All Rights Reserved. 恒訊科技 深圳市恒訊科技有限公司 粵ICP備20052954號 IDC證:B1-20230800.移動站


